Apprenticeships are a key area for the College and its customers, providing opportunities for learners to earn as they learn and develop a career.

To support and enhance the apprentice and employer experience through effective skills coaching and tutoring. The skills coach will be a subject matter specialist and will be required to visit each apprentice once every quarter for the entire duration of their programme. They will also be required to have regular ongoing contact with all learners & employers and complete all the relevant paperwork and update all records relating to learner progress. This job will involve extensive travelling, as apprentices must be visited at their place of employment. A driving licence and regular access to a vehicle is essential and evening work may be required.

Responsibilities for the role of Apprenticeship Skills Tutor

· To support learners to provide evidence on behaviours, underpinning knowledge, work-based skills, learning & overall progress for each apprentice

· To provide coaching and skills support to ensure successful timely completion of End Point Assessment (EPA)

· Work with curriculum colleagues to check learner progress is to agreed targets in preparation of tripartite reviews

· To conduct regular tripartite reviews with the apprentice line manager and apprentice to successfully complete timely EPA

· To support the development and progression of a caseload of apprentices through onsite workplace visits in the creation of showcase evidence such as observations, reflective accounts, witness testimonies, professional discussions and any further evidence to support EPA requirements, this evidence will be documented within the e-portfolio OneFile

· To highlight & document any operational issues to the line manager which may affect learner progression as appropriate

· To set achievable tasks and provide support throughout the apprentice journey including assisting the apprentice to be prepared for any applicable qualification including functional skills, endpoint assessment, and other relevant achievement documentation

· To support employers in understanding & documenting their responsibilities relating to on and off-job training requirements of the apprentice

· To provide pastoral support to apprentices as required including on & off the job training/e-portfolio usage and any additional support needs & strategies

· To provide advice, guidance & training regarding Safeguarding, British Values, Prevent and Equality & Diversity and be responsible for ensuring that the workplace provides an ongoing safe environment

· To meet with the employer & learner to agree EPA readiness

· General administration tasks including ensuring accurate learner data within all software packages, monitoring learner attendance & targets, completing all required documentation within the agreed timescales and regular use of Outlook calendars

· To participate & document in all professional development as required
